Default True Siamese Alage eaters dying

I bought six Siamese algae eaters which have been in my quaranteen tank for
a week and a half.
After a week for of them have died in successive days. Prior to them dying,
all were very active and did not
show any visible signs of sickness. On the quarantine tank I feed them
antibacterial food and add some melafix/pimafix.
The other two left swim with the dwarf corys I have in the same tank.

Are these fish very delicate? Any suggestions why they might be dying?
